Of the great happiness of being an aunt

The article is a personal reflection by Ricarda Opis on her experience of becoming an aunt and the deep emotional connection she developed with her niece. It describes the author’s initial feelings upon meeting her niece as a newborn, comparing her to whimsical creatures like fireflies and bears. The piece explores themes of love, responsibility, and the unique bond between an aunt and niece, highlighting the author’s role in supporting her sister during the early stages of motherhood. The narrative includes anecdotes about caring for the baby, the challenges of learning to care for a child, and the emotional significance of this relationship.
